A Beginner’s Comprehensive Guide To Car Rentals In Chania

For the first time, car rental Chania can be scary and exciting simultaneously. A car rental opens up a world of possibilities when you travel, but there are some problems you would want to avoid.


Points to consider before renting a car


You would need a driver’s license.
The first thing that the agent will ask to see is driver’s license. A photocopy will not cut it, and a prepaid card won’t work either. You might be able to rent a car with a debit card, but it is likely to create some hassles.

Rates are same for young drivers
Renters under the age of 25 will not encounter daily, age-related fees on rentals, which cannot exceed the cost of the rental car. Young drivers don’t need to pay more by the rental car company unless the renter has booked and asked for some special service.

You can overpay for car rental insurance
A large portion of the car rental contract concerns what happens if the vehicle is in an accident and who is responsible for covering the costs of damage. Before car rental Chania, you should do the homework and find out whether the car insurance you have on your car covers rental cars, and whether the credit card includes coverage for rental cars.

What to do when you pick up the rental car?

Respect return and pickup timings
Rental car reservations are guaranteed for the assigned pickup time. Early pick up or late return, and the rate might get changed. Know that the staff won’t keep the office open for you if you are arriving late.

Bring your credit card, ID and confirmation number
The rental company will ask to see your credit card and driving license. It is always safer to have the rental confirmation handy.

Inspect the vehicle
Before you get in the car and drive off the lot, inspect the interior, glass, and exterior of the vehicle. Take pictures of any scratches or damage that you find and ask the company to record it before you leave.

Important Facts you need to consider when renting a Car in Chania

The historical city of Chania is a great place to spend some time in your Mediterranean holiday. Astonishing natural beauty and warm blue skies attract thousands of tourists each year. If you are on a holiday to Crete, it is highly likely that you will spend some time in the city and its surroundings. The best way to see the town is to hire your own car and go and see the places you want to enjoy.

However, there are a few things you should keep in mind while booking the right car for yourself. Let’s look at some important facts you need to consider when renting a car in Chania.

Most places in the city are within walking distance: Chania is a seaside town, and most of the places to see in the city like the museums and the markets are within walking distance of the major hotels. If you plan to stay in the city for only a couple of days and spend the next few exploring the island, then it makes sense to not book a car right away. If you are traveling from any of the other cities such as Heraklion, then it is most likely you already have a car. However, if you have used the airport to get in, then take a taxi to the hotel and enjoy the city on foot first. Once your city trips are over, opt for the car rental companies who will give you a good car to travel around the city and its outskirts.

Know what papers you need: Like in the rest of the world, Greece requires foreign travelers to carry certain documents with them – especially if they are hiring a rental car and traveling on their own. Keep these documents like your passport, driving license, and insurance papers handy.

Book the car that you can drive: Most people suggest that hire the car of your dreams when you are traveling abroad. The truth is the opposite. When abroad, hire the most sensible care around. It is especially good if you have driven that make before and know the quirks that the car model generally has. This will help you to enjoy Crete and not be bogged down by a car that you find difficult to drive.
